Output 900e6834bbaaa32be21781a2c724a8a0db0a98048215d18e5230bd1f6b018807:0

value
93753662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f717102d389665c8e798e1d399f176eb8b1aed5 OP_EQUAL
address
MSp21Bvcq3vvAm6fLGXwNHepSzyUPwosJb
transaction
900e6834bbaaa32be21781a2c724a8a0db0a98048215d18e5230bd1f6b018807
spent
true